Cong to take out state-wide peace marches on Oct 31

In view of the recent incidents of communal violence in the state and to highlight the need for restoring peace, Congressmen will take out silent peace marches on the death anniversary of former prime minister Indira Gandhi on October 31.
On the call of UPCC president Nirmal Khatri, district and city units of the party will take out maun shanti marches all across the state on October 31, Congress spokesman Virendra Madan said.
Congressmen have been asked to carry only party flags and placards having messages of peace and amity and play Gandhiji's bhajans, Madan said.
The UPCC president has assigned senior leaders the responsibility of making the march programme a success, he added.
